About this property
Gingersnap Cottage with Log Burner by LetMeStay
Summary:
Gingersnap Cottage is a beautifully styled Lakeland hideaway, offering a calm and comfortable base for exploring Ambleside and the surrounding fells. Thoughtfully furnished and full of character, this welcoming cottage is ideal for couples, families or friends looking to relax, recharge and enjoy everything the Lakes have to offer.
The Space:
The ground floor is open-plan and sociable, with slate flooring throughout and a warm, inviting feel. The sitting area centres around a wood-burning stove, perfect for cosy evenings after long walks, alongside comfortable leather seating and a TV.
The fully equipped kitchen has everything you need for relaxed self-catering, including modern appliances, ample worktop space and a breakfast bar for casual dining, morning coffee or planning the day’s adventures.
Bedrooms & bathroom
Upstairs you’ll find two thoughtfully presented bedrooms:
A king-size bedroom with an ornamental fireplace and peaceful fell views
A bunk bedroom with full-size mattresses, ideal for children or additional guests
The modern shower room features a walk-in shower, basin and WC, finished in a clean, contemporary style.
Dog-friendly (up to two well-behaved dogs welcome)
Guest Access:
Guest's are able to use the whole property throughout their stay
The Neighborhood:
The cottage sits in a quiet residential area, just a short walk downhill to Ambleside’s shops, cafés and restaurants. Walks and fell routes are easily accessible nearby, making this an excellent base for exploring the wider Lake District without needing to drive every day.
Whether you’re returning muddy boots after a fell walk or curling up by the fire with a glass of wine, Gingersnap Cottage is a relaxed, welcoming place to slow down and enjoy your time in the Lakes.
Getting Around:
Public Transport is available from Kelsick Road, Ambleside
Gingersnap Cottage does not have dedicated parking but you can usually find a space on Blue Hill Road, directly outside the property.
